Super High Vision offers a screen resolution that is 16 times greater than the existing HD screen. The new technology will require a screen size of at least 60 inches and developers have demonstrated vast 600 inch screens. This is a far cry from the average screen size of 12inches that existed in the 50s.
The only problem the new technology may face is the fact that it is so large. People that want to replace their current screen will have to find room for a 60 inch screen in their home. The developer has also admitted that if you are too close whilst watching the screen it may make you feel sick.
